- you
- [juː]
-
Listen
- 1. refers to the person addressed or to more than one person including the person or persons addressed but not including the speaker
- 2. one refers to an unspecified person or people in general
- 3.
a dialect word for yourself yourselves
- 4. the personality of the person being addressed or something that expresses it
- 5. Old English e ow, dative and accusative of g e ye 1 ; related to Old Saxon eu, Old High German iu, Gothic izwis
